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Microsoft SQL Server Новый топик    Ответить
 Вопрос по поводу переноса базы  [new]
silfi
Member

Откуда:
Сообщений: 9
Добрый день, до этого момента баз данных касался только поверхностно и знаний о них у меня немного. Опишу ситуацию, на windows 2003 сервере(который собирается помереть) стоит ms sql 2000, он ещё работает. Там крутится простейшая база данных. Куплен новый сервер и на него поставлена система Windows 2008 R2.

Вопрос - как перенести и конвертировать данные на новый сервер, в идеале если туда поставить ms sql 2008 express(бесплатную), если в express невозможно, то будет куплена ms sql standart.

Спасибо за понимание и помощь.
29 июл 13, 11:46    [14631060]     Ответить | Цитировать Сообщить модератору
 Re: Вопрос по поводу переноса базы  [new]
Сергей Викт.
Member

Откуда: Москва
Сообщений: 888
silfi
Добрый день, до этого момента баз данных касался только поверхностно и знаний о них у меня немного. Опишу ситуацию, на windows 2003 сервере(который собирается помереть) стоит ms sql 2000, он ещё работает. Там крутится простейшая база данных. Куплен новый сервер и на него поставлена система Windows 2008 R2.

Вопрос - как перенести и конвертировать данные на новый сервер, в идеале если туда поставить ms sql 2008 express(бесплатную), если в express невозможно, то будет куплена ms sql standart.

Спасибо за понимание и помощь.

Backup на старом сервере -> Restore на новый.
29 июл 13, 11:58    [14631132]     Ответить | Цитировать Сообщить модератору
 Re: Вопрос по поводу переноса базы  [new]
Сергей Викт.
Member

Откуда: Москва
Сообщений: 888
Тут писали уже
Вообще по форуму очень много топиков о переносе базы данных.
29 июл 13, 11:59    [14631141]     Ответить | Цитировать Сообщить модератору
 Re: Вопрос по поводу переноса базы  [new]
silfi
Member

Откуда:
Сообщений: 9
Бэкап сделал, через что делать restore датабазы на 2008 express?
Import and restore data wizard?
29 июл 13, 12:07    [14631201]     Ответить | Цитировать Сообщить модератору
 Re: Вопрос по поводу переноса базы  [new]
Сергей Викт.
Member

Откуда: Москва
Сообщений: 888
silfi
Бэкап сделал, через что делать restore датабазы на 2008 express?
Import and restore data wizard?

Через SSMS. Databases -> Restore Database
29 июл 13, 12:10    [14631220]     Ответить | Цитировать Сообщить модератору
 Re: Вопрос по поводу переноса базы  [new]
alexeyvg
Member

Откуда: Moscow
Сообщений: 31949
silfi
в идеале если туда поставить ms sql 2008 express(бесплатную), если в express невозможно, то будет куплена ms sql standart.
1. Приложение может быть несовместимо с ms sql 2000
2. express может не поддерживать фич, которые использует ваша система.

Так что тестируйте тщательно после переноса, не выкидывайте сразу старый сервер, особенно учитывая, что вы не специалист.
29 июл 13, 12:14    [14631246]     Ответить | Цитировать Сообщить модератору
 Re: Вопрос по поводу переноса базы  [new]
silfi
Member

Откуда:
Сообщений: 9
Подскажите а как теперь перенести пользователей? их довольно много чтобы переносить вручную
Можно ли это сделать, забекапив/восстановив системню таблицу? Микрософт дает скрипт http://support.microsoft.com/kb/246133/ru
Но он для переноса на 2005, а надо на 2008
29 июл 13, 12:51    [14631477]     Ответить | Цитировать Сообщить модератору
 Re: Вопрос по поводу переноса базы  [new]
mag2000
Member

Откуда:
Сообщений: 187
silfi,
По приведенной вами ссылке:
автор
Способ 1
Этот способ применим в указанных ниже случаях.
•Перемещение имен пользователей и паролей SQL Server 7.0 в SQL Server 7.0.
•Перемещение имен пользователей и паролей SQL Server 7.0 в SQL Server 2000.
•Перемещение имен пользователей и паролей SQL Server 2000 в SQL Server 2000.
29 июл 13, 13:18    [14631671]     Ответить | Цитировать Сообщить модератору
 Re: Вопрос по поводу переноса базы  [new]
mag2000
Member

Откуда:
Сообщений: 187
mag2000,
Извиняюсь, не увидел, что вы переходите на 2008 Express...
29 июл 13, 13:20    [14631681]     Ответить | Цитировать Сообщить модератору
 Re: Вопрос по поводу переноса базы  [new]
mag2000
Member

Откуда:
Сообщений: 187
silfi,
Скорее ваш способ 2 по той же ссылке
http://support.microsoft.com/kb/246133/ru

Или вот еще разные варианты:
http://blog.netnerds.net/2009/01/migratetransfer-sql-server-2008200520007-logins-to-sql-server-2008/
29 июл 13, 13:31    [14631751]     Ответить | Цитировать Сообщить модератору
 Re: Вопрос по поводу переноса базы  [new]
silfi
Member

Откуда:
Сообщений: 9
Пытаюсь выполнить скрипт, в резултате вываливается эта ошибка.
http://i47.fastpic.ru/big/2013/0729/a4/3b4a3c39fec56a3bd6aa45156892fca4.jpg

Выполняю
http://blog.netnerds.net/2009/01/migratetransfer-sql-server-2008200520007-logins-to-sql-server-2008/
2 скрипт.
29 июл 13, 15:28    [14632601]     Ответить | Цитировать Сообщить модератору
Все форумы / Microsoft SQL Server Ответить